Excel填充不同数据库技巧,如何快速实现数据同步?
Excel要填充不同的数据库,可以通过1、使用数据连接导入法;2、借助零代码开发平台简道云实现自动同步;3、利用VBA脚本或第三方插件等方式。推荐优先采用简道云零代码开发平台,因其无需编程即可批量对接Excel与多类数据库,实现数据自动同步与高效管理。例如,通过简道云的“数据集成”功能,用户只需配置对应的数据源信息,即可将Excel表格内容与MySQL、SQL Server等主流数据库无缝对接,后续数据更新也能实时同步,无需人工反复操作,大大提高效率和准确性。建议企业数字化转型优先尝试低门槛平台,以降低成本并规避开发风险。
《excel如何填充不同的数据库》
官网地址: https://www.jiandaoyun.com/register?utm_src=nbwzseonlzc;
一、EXCEL填充不同数据库的主要方法
实际工作中,Excel与数据库的数据互通需求非常普遍。下表总结了三种常见方法及其适用场景:
| 方法 | 适用人群 | 操作难度 | 支持数据库类型 | 主要优缺点 |
|---|---|---|---|---|
| 数据连接导入 | 办公人员/初级用户 | 较低 | Access/SQL/MySQL | 简单直观,但灵活性有限 |
| 简道云零代码开发平台 | 各类业务人员 | 极低 | 多种主流数据库 | 无需编程,自动化强 |
| VBA脚本/第三方插件 | 有一定技术基础者 | 较高 | 灵活(取决于方案) | 可定制性强,但维护成本高 |
方法一:EXCEL自带“数据-从外部导入”功能
- 步骤:
- 打开Excel,选择“数据”选项卡 → “获取数据” → “自其他源” →如“从SQL Server数据库”。
- 填写服务器地址、登录信息,选择目标库及表。
- 导入后可在Excel中直接编辑和分析。
- 优缺点分析:简单易用,无需额外工具,但仅支持部分主流关系型数据库,对结构复杂或多源混合场景支持有限。
方法二:采用简道云零代码开发平台(推荐)
- 核心优势:
- 支持多种异构数据库(MySQL、Oracle、SQLServer、PostgreSQL等)。
- 可通过拖拉拽配置,将Excel表单作为输入源,一键同步到目标库。
- 提供丰富的自动化流程,可设置定时触发或变更即同步,无须手动操作。
- 数据处理全程可视化,无需写代码,极大降低门槛。
- 使用场景举例:
- 企业每月销售报表由各个分支以Excel上报,总部通过简道云统一收集后,自动归档至业务系统后台数据库。
- 科研机构将实验记录以Excel录入,通过简道云批量导入科研管理系统,实现智能归档和权限分配。
方法三:VBA脚本或插件工具
- 操作流程:
- 安装相关驱动程序(如ODBC)。
- 编写VBA宏脚本连接对应数据库,并按照字段映射批量插入或更新数据。
- 特点分析:
- 技术门槛较高,需要懂得一定编程知识;
- 可实现复杂的数据处理逻辑,如条件判断或动态生成SQL语句;
- 不利于后续运维和团队协作。
二、简道云零代码开发平台详细解析
简道云概述
简道云是国内领先的低/零代码应用搭建平台之一,其核心特点是让非专业IT人员也能快速搭建企业级业务系统。其“集成中心”和“表单设计器”等模块极大提升了 Excel 与企业各类业务系统/数据库之间的数据交互效率。
常见应用场景
- 企业级报表收集与归档
- 供应链上下游协同
- 客户资料批量录入与维护
- 跨部门、多地办公的信息整合
平台核心能力
- 一键导入:支持直接上传 Excel 文件为新表,也能将其内容增量追加至现有业务库;
- 多源对接:提供丰富的数据连接器,可同时对接多种异构库(如MySQL+Oracle+MongoDB等);
- 自动同步:可设置定时任务,实现定期从 Excel 源文件读取并推送到目标库;
- 权限管控:细粒度权限配置确保敏感信息安全流转;
- 流程自动化:配合审批流/触发器实现无人值守的数据运维。
使用步骤示例
- 注册并登录 简道云官网
- 新建“数据集成”任务——选择来源类型为 Excel 文件
- 设置目标为所需类型的外部数据库,并填写连接参数
- 完善字段映射关系,可自定义转换规则
- 配置同步频率(实时/定时)
- 启动任务,即可实现持续、高效同步
理论优势分析
- 降低IT参与门槛,让前线员工直接驱动数字化转型进程
- 避免重复造轮子,提高整体项目上线速度和灵活调整能力
- 平台已内置大量模板&行业最佳实践,如采购管理、人事档案等,可快速复用
三、多种方式对比及适用建议
为帮助用户更好地选择方法,下表罗列了常见方案特点:
| 对比维度 | EXCEL自带功能 | 简道云零代码平台 | VBA脚本及插件 |
|---|---|---|---|
| 支持库范围 | 主流关系型有限 | 几乎所有主流&异构 | 理论无限 |
| 操作难度 | 易 | 极易 | 高 |
| 自动化程度 | 手动刷新 | 全自动 | 可定制 |
| 成本&维护 | 无显著额外成本 | 按项目需求付费 | 高昂的人力&技术投入 |
| 扩展性 | 弱 | 强 | 高 |
推荐选型原则
- 若为一次性简单导出/导入,小规模操作——直接用Excel内置功能即可;
- 若涉及多部门、多频次、大体量的数据交换,以及希望无IT介入——建议首选简道云等零代码SaaS平台;
- 若有高度个性化逻辑且IT资源充足——可以考虑基于VBA脚本甚至专属插件进行深度定制。
四、安全性与合规性的考量
在实际接入过程中,不同解决方案在安全合规方面表现差异明显:
- 权限控制 简道云支持企业级权限体系设定,比如字段级别加密、防止越权访问;而传统EXCEL只能靠文件加密,风险较大。
- 操作审计 简道云提供详细日志回溯,有助于问题追踪和责任界定;VBA脚本往往很难做到全流程留痕。
- 容灾备份机制 平台自带备份&恢复机制,避免因误操作造成不可逆损失,而手工模式则难以保障可靠性。
五、典型案例剖析
案例A —— 某连锁餐饮集团统一销售报表归档
背景:全国30+门店每天用EXCEL上报销售明细,需要实时汇总到总部财务系统(MySQL)。
解决方案:
- 总部在简道云搭建“销售上报汇总”应用,各店长只需上传标准格式EXCEL文件;
- 平台自动识别并按规则写入总部MySQL,每日0人工处理;
- 财务主管随时在线查看最新汇总结果,并可一键下钻查询历史明细;
效果:
- 人工整理时间减少90%,数据准确率提升至99%以上;
案例B —— 制造业BOM清单批量录入ERP
背景:原有ERP不支持BOM大批量手工录入,每次新产品上线都需要几百行EXCEL逐条复制粘贴,非常耗时。
解决方案:
- 利用简道云将BOM EXCEL模板结构映射到ERP后台Oracle库,每次只需上传一次,即刻完成全部物料编码注册;
效果:
- 新品上线周期缩短50%,技术员无须再耗费大量时间重复劳动。
六、高阶技巧与常见问题解答
常见问题Q&A
Q1: Excel中含有公式或下拉列表,对应填充到数据库会不会出错? A: 一般情况下,只要最终上传的是“值”,不会影响;如涉及复杂嵌套逻辑,可提前在EXCEL做一次纯值保存再上传。使用简道云时还可以指定忽略空白列或者做格式清洗,有效避免异常。
Q2: 数据量很大(比如几十万条),会不会卡顿? A: 零代码平台通常采用分块传输和异步处理机制,大幅减轻前端负载压力,相比原始手工粘贴稳定得多。如遇超大体积,还可考虑批次分段推送或者后台API方式补充扩展。
Q3: 万一遇到字段不匹配怎么办? A: 简道云允许自定义字段映射规则,自由调整目标库结构,也能做必要的数据格式转换,非常灵活!
总结与建议
综上所述,“Excel如何填充不同的数据库”,推荐优先选用像简道云这样的零代码开发平台,它凭借低门槛、高兼容、多重安全保障以及丰富的行业模板,可以极大提升办公效率与信息质量。如果你只是偶尔小规模转存,可以继续使用Office自身工具,但面对复杂、多变且跨部门的大型任务,则应果断采用更专业的平台。同时建议:
- 提前梳理好自身业务流程及具体需求,再选择最适合的方法;
- 注重权限、安全及数据一致性的控制,不盲目依赖手工操作;
- 善于利用新兴SaaS服务,把技术壁垒交给专业厂商,让自己专注核心业务创新!
最后推荐:
100+企业管理系统模板免费使用>>>无需下载,在线安装: https://s.fanruan.com/l0cac
精品问答:
Excel如何连接并填充不同类型的数据库?
我在使用Excel时,想把数据从不同类型的数据库导入到表格中,但不太清楚具体操作步骤和注意事项。Excel连接数据库的流程是怎样的?需要注意哪些细节?
Excel支持通过“数据”选项卡下的“获取数据”功能连接多种数据库,例如SQL Server、MySQL和Access。具体步骤包括:
- 选择“获取数据” > “来自数据库”,然后选择对应数据库类型。
- 输入服务器地址、数据库名称及登录凭证。
- 选择需要导入的数据表或执行SQL查询。
- 导入后,可利用Excel的数据透视表和公式进行分析。
注意事项:
- 确保安装相应数据库驱动(如ODBC驱动)。
- 保持网络连接稳定,避免数据传输中断。
- 对于大型数据库,建议分批导入以防止Excel卡顿。
怎样使用Excel自动填充不同数据库中的数据?
我想实现Excel自动更新不同数据库中的数据,而不是每次都手动导入,这样能提高工作效率。有哪些方法可以实现这种自动填充功能?需要用到哪些工具或插件?
可以通过Excel的“Power Query”功能实现从多个数据库自动刷新数据:
步骤如下:
- 使用Power Query连接目标数据库,配置查询语句。
- 设置查询加载到工作表或数据模型。
- 在“查询属性”中启用“后台刷新”和设定刷新频率。
此外,也可结合VBA脚本编写自动更新宏,或者使用第三方插件如ODBC链接管理器实现更复杂的数据同步。这样,每次打开文件或按需刷新时,Excel即可实时拉取最新数据,提高效率和准确性。
如何保证Excel与多种数据库之间的数据一致性?
我担心从不同数据库填充到Excel的数据会出现不一致或格式错误,这会影响后续分析。有什么技巧或者工具能帮助保证数据同步和格式统一吗?
确保多源数据一致性,可以采取以下措施:
| 措施 | 说明 |
|---|---|
| 数据清洗与预处理 | 在Power Query中统一字段格式,如日期、数字格式等 |
| 建立统一的数据模型 | 使用Power Pivot构建关系型模型,减少重复和冲突 |
| 定期校验与比较 | 利用条件格式和公式对比历史版本检测异常 |
| 自动化脚本监控 | 编写VBA脚本定时检查关键字段变化 |
案例:某公司利用Power Query自动提取ERP系统与CRM系统数据,通过建立统一字段映射,有效避免了客户信息重复导致的混乱,提高了报告准确率20%。
在Excel填充不同数据库时如何优化性能?
我发现从大型数据库导入大量数据到Excel时,经常出现卡顿甚至崩溃,这让我很头疼。有没有什么性能优化的方法可以让我顺畅操作并快速完成填充任务?
针对性能优化,可以考虑以下策略:
- 限制导入范围:只导入必要字段和行数,避免全量拉取大量无关数据;
- 分批加载:将大表拆分为多个小查询逐步导入;
- 使用筛选条件:在SQL查询中添加WHERE条件预筛选;
- 关闭自动计算:临时关闭公式自动计算,加快操作速度;
- 升级硬件配置:确保电脑具备足够内存(建议≥16GB)和SSD硬盘以提升读写速度。
根据微软官方数据显示,通过合理筛选减少70%无关列,可提升40%以上的数据加载速度,有效缓解卡顿问题。
文章版权归"
转载请注明出处:https://www.jiandaoyun.com/nblog/84041/
温馨提示:文章由AI大模型生成,如有侵权,联系 mumuerchuan@gmail.com
删除。